China and Russia called for the de-escalation of tensions in Eastern Ukraine calling crisis as “domestic” issue

Moscow: Russian President Vladimir Putin and Chinese President Xi Jinping believe that Ukraine crisis is a domestic issue and should be resolve peacefully and in a political way, reports Russian media on Tuesday.

In a joint statement issued by both leaders, Putin and Xi urged Ukrainians to start “broad nationwide talks” on ending their country’s crisis. Russia is of the view that Ukraine should invite eastern leaders for peace talks while Ukrainian government has refused to invite eastern leaders that Ukraine call “separatist rebels” for any negotiation and is using power to solve crises in eastern Ukraine.

Both world leaders in a statement after their meeting at a start of a two-day meeting of Conference on Interaction and Confidence Building Measures in Asia (CICA) also attended a signing ceremony where both countries inked 49 cooperation deals in fields including energy, transport and infrastructure.

Conference on Interaction and Confidence Building Measures in Asia (CICA) is a multi-national forum for enhancing cooperation towards promoting peace, security and stability in Asia. It is a forum based on the recognition that there is close link between peace, security and stability in Asia and in the rest of the world. The Member States, while affirming their commitment to the UN Charter, believe that peace and security in Asia can be achieved through dialogue and cooperation leading to a common indivisible area of security in Asia where all states co-exist peacefully and their peoples live in peace, freedom and prosperity.

The idea of convening the CICA was first proposed by H.E. Mr. Nursultan Nazarbayev, President of the Republic of Kazakhstan, on 5 October 1992, at the 47th Session of the United Nations General Assembly. The moving spirit behind this initiative was the aspiration to set up an efficient and acceptable structure for ensuring peace and security in Asia. Unlike other regions in the world, Asia did not have such a structure at that time and earlier attempts to create a suitable structure had not been very successful. This initiative was supported by a number of Asian countries who felt that such a structure was the need of the time.
